Driving home from her doctor’s office, Dot Thompson couldn’t stop thinking about the news she had just received: “In two to three years, you’ll be taking insulin.” Her mind turned to her father, who passed away due to complicati­ons from type 2 diabetes. If I don’t do something, I’ll be on track for congestive heart failure, just like him.

Overweight since she was 19, Dot had tried nearly every type of diet, but nothing worked. She was taking medication for high blood pressure and was plagued by insomnia, acid reflux and back pain. “I couldn’t even walk to my mailbox without pain,” she shares.

Everything changed when Dot read about the ketogenic diet and decided to give it a try. She cut out carbs and started filling up on fatty cuts of meat. She also added fat bombs to her diet. “After I eat a fat bomb, I have a burst of energy,” she cheers. “Enjoying them is a treat so I don’t feel deprived.”

It didn’t take long for Dot’s body to respond: She lost 5 pounds a week, plus her acid reflux disappeare­d after seven days. “My sleep improved too,” she says. “I used to get only four hours a night but now I get seven.”

Flash-forward 12 months: Dot had transforme­d her body and reversed her high blood sugar. “My doctor said he’d never seen someone make a turnaround that fast!”

Now that the excess weight isn’t holding her back, Dot couldn’t be happier. She’s discovered a new zest for life—including a love for shopping. “When

I put on a pair of jeans, I looked in the mirror and cried tears of joy. I feel like I could do anything!”
